Why Is Parking So Important for a Corporate Event in Rome?

When organising a professional event, parking is not a minor detail.
It can directly affect:
- guest punctuality;
- accessibility;
- attendee experience;
- arrival management;
- pre-event stress;
- departure times at the end of the day;
- overall perception of the event.

Imagine an event starting at 9:30 a.m. One attendee reaches the area at 9:10 but spends 30 minutes searching for parking.
Another finds a space far from the venue. A third calls the organiser asking where to leave the car.
The event has not even started, yet the organiser is already dealing with problems that could potentially have been reduced by choosing a more suitable venue.
For this reason, searching for a corporate event venue in Rome with parking can be particularly important when a significant number of guests are travelling by car.

How to Choose a Corporate Event Venue in Rome

There is no single perfect venue for every event. The right choice depends on the event format, number of attendees and, above all, how guests will reach the venue.
Before booking, it's useful to answer a few key questions.

How many people will attend?
A 15-person meeting has very different requirements from a large conference.
For smaller groups, a more focused setting can encourage communication, networking and interaction.

Where are attendees travelling from?
This is one of the most important questions.
Are they travelling:
- from central Rome?
- from the suburbs?
- from other regions?
- via the motorway?
- by car?
- by public transport?

The answer can completely change the ideal location.

How many guests will drive?
Don't simply count the number of attendees. Estimate how many vehicles will actually arrive.
Thirty attendees do not necessarily mean thirty cars: some guests may travel together, while others may use taxis or public transport.
This estimate helps you assess parking requirements more accurately.

How long will the event last?
A two-hour meeting requires a different setup from a full-day corporate event.
If the event lasts all day, the following also become important:
- coffee breaks;
- lunch;
- buffet options;
- common areas;
- comfort;
- an optional aperitif;
- accommodation for guests travelling from outside Rome.

How Many Parking Spaces Do You Need for a Corporate Event?

There is no universal formula.
Consider:
- total number of guests;
- where attendees are travelling from;
- car sharing;
- taxis or private transfers;
- local attendees;
- guests already staying at the hotel.

A useful question to include in your registration form is: "How will you travel to the venue?"
Possible answers:
- car;
- taxi/private transfer;
- public transport;
- other.

This allows organisers to estimate the expected number of vehicles more accurately.
Always confirm parking availability, access arrangements and applicable conditions directly with the venue for your specific event date, especially when a large number of guests are expected to drive.

Full-Day Corporate Event: How to Organise the Programme

For a full-day event, it's essential to build a realistic timeline.
A possible programme might be:

8:30 a.m. – Arrival and Welcome
Guests arrive, park and make their way to the meeting room.

9:00 a.m. – Opening Session
Introduction and first working session.

10:45 a.m. – Coffee Break
A short break to recharge and network.

11:15 a.m. – Second Session
The programme continues.

1:00 p.m. – Lunch Break
Lunch, buffet or another food and beverage solution.

2:00 p.m. – Afternoon Session
Workshop, training or operational meeting.

4:00 p.m. – Break
A second networking opportunity.

4:30 p.m. – Final Session
Conclusions, questions and next steps.

5:30 p.m. – End of Event
Depending on the format, the day may continue with an aperitif, dinner or overnight stay.

Hotel or Standalone Venue for a Corporate Event?

The answer depends on your requirements. A standalone venue may be suitable when you only need the event space.

A hotel may be more practical when you also require:
- meeting room;
- parking;
- accommodation;
- reception services;
- breakfast;
- coffee breaks;
- food and beverage;
- common areas.

The comparison should therefore go beyond the room hire price. Consider the total cost of organising the event.
A cheaper standalone room may require separate catering, parking, accommodation and transport arrangements. An integrated venue can reduce the number of suppliers you need to coordinate.
